UPF intake may influence energy intake and metabolic responses through factors like energy density, eating rate, and hyper-palatability, but these mechanisms are not yet fully understood.

Try to be mindful of how quickly you eat and the energy density of your meals. UPFs are often designed to be hyper-palatable and energy-dense, which can lead to overconsumption. Choosing whole, minimally processed foods may help regulate energy intake.

What, if any, attributes of UPFs influence ingestive behavior and contribute to excess energy intake? What, if any, attributes of UPFs contribute to clinically meaningful metabolic responses?
Lauren E O’Connor et al. · Advances in Nutrition · 2023

Why this rating

Some controlled feeding trials show differences in energy intake, but results are mixed and mechanisms are not fully established.
